Nov 8, 2019 · 7. How many owners has this RV had? Ideally, the private party you’re buying from will be the only owner the rig has had — the more owners, the more potential for damage, wear-and-tear, and serious repairs you don’t know about. You may want to invest in a vehicle history, which you can get from a company like RVchecks.

Coaches less than 10 years old, gas motorhomes under 60,000 miles, and diesel RVs below 100,000 miles can get financed but be ready for a higher down payment and an increased APR. This is one of my favorite full time stationary RV living tips because you can stop worrying about …The standard Texas RV sales tax is 6.25% of the purchase price, but this rate can vary based on any additional local taxes. However, the total tax rate in Texas cannot exceed 8.25%. Given this, if you’re buying an RV priced at $100,000, you can expect to pay a Texas RV sales tax ranging between $6,250 to $8,250.
